Abstract
The interactions of cadmium (Cd) ions with mannans from six species of yeast were studied using equilibrium dialysis. Among the six mannans examined, the binding capacity of the mannan of Saccharomyces carlsbergensis was the greatest, at about 146 .mu.mol/g mannan. For the other mannans, the amounts of bound metal ions ranged from 20-46 .mu.mol/g mannan. However, the dissociation constants of Cd-binding to each mannan were very siilar, at about 0.5 .times. 10-3 M. Scatchard plot analysis indicted that the mannans had a single type of binding sites. Pronase digestion of the mannans decreased their total nitrogen, accompanied with significant losses of Cd-binding.
